在starrcoks中,新建内部表时可以设置的PROPERTIES全部选项如下:

  1. ROW FORMAT: 设置内部表的行格式,可以选择的值包括:

    • DELIMITED: 行以特定的分隔符进行分隔,可以使用FIELDS TERMINATED BY和LINES TERMINATED BY子句指定分隔符。
    • SERDE: 行使用自定义的序列化/反序列化器进行处理,可以使用WITH SERDE子句指定序列化/反序列化器。
  2. STORED AS: 设置内部表的存储格式,可以选择的值包括:

    • TEXTFILE: 表以文本文件的形式存储。
    • SEQUENCEFILE: 表以Hadoop序列文件的形式存储。
    • ORC: 表以ORC文件的形式存储。
    • PARQUET: 表以Parquet文件的形式存储。
  3. LOCATION: 设置内部表的存储路径,指定内部表在HDFS中的存储位置。

  4. TBLPROPERTIES: 设置附加的表属性,可以使用键值对的形式指定属性。例如:

    • 'key1'='value1': 设置属性key1的值为value1。
    • 'key2'='value2': 设置属性key2的值为value2。

这些选项可以根据具体的需求进行设置,以满足内部表的存储和访问需求

starrcoks新建内部表的PROPERTIES全部选项

原文地址: https://www.cveoy.top/t/topic/h4lN 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录